Psychological Drivers: Why Players Stay Hooked

The excitement generated by chance is only one facet of online casino gaming; emotional triggers also play a pivotal role in maintaining player engagement. Multiple factors, such as vibrant graphics, captivating sounds, and festive animations, elicit positive feelings that elevate the gaming experience. For many players, the thrill of winning—even modest amounts—can initiate dopamine release, strengthening a cycle of continued play. Moreover, social interactions, whether through communication features or collaborative games, foster a sense of community and belonging, further deepening emotional investment. Gamification elements, such as bonuses and accomplishments, offer players tangible markers of progress, which can increase enthusiasm and involvement. The suspense built through progressive jackpots and bonus rounds also heightens emotional stakes, making players more likely to return. Combined, these emotional triggers establish an engaging atmosphere that sustains player involvement and enthusiastically engaging with online casino experiences.

Typical Cognitive Biases in Online Gambling

Cognitive biases have a major impact in determining players' perceptions and decisions in digital gambling. A common bias is the illusion of control, where gamblers assume they can manipulate chance-based results, such as slot machine spins or card draws. This belief can result in increased gambling activity, as players feel empowered regardless of the underlying chance. A further widespread bias is the gambler's error, which causes players to assume that historical events impact future likelihoods. As an example, a player might think a series of defeats raises the chances of success. Additionally, positive reinforcement bias causes players to emphasize successes while ignoring failures, strengthening the notion that wagering is a profitable approach. Ultimately, the loss recovery fallacy prompts players to continue gambling to recoup previous losses, reinforcing their engagement in destructive habits. Recognizing these psychological tendencies is essential for understanding gambler psychology and the mental mechanisms involved in internet-based betting platforms.

Techniques for Responsible Gaming: Maintaining Balance

Many approaches are available to encourage safe gambling practices, assisting players in developing a balanced connection with online gambling. Setting a budget is fundamental; individuals should define their financial boundaries before playing and follow them consistently. Time management is equally essential; scheduling dedicated gaming sessions can reduce the risk of excessive play. Several gaming sites include self-exclusion options, giving players the ability to pause their gaming activity as required. Regularly evaluating one's gaming habits can foster awareness of patterns that may signal problematic behavior. Furthermore, gamblers are advised to reach out to trusted contacts or professional services when experiencing stress or compulsive urges. Understanding the odds and recognizing that losses are part of gaming can also mitigate unrealistic expectations. In the end, a well-rounded strategy that values fun over monetary reward ensures that online gambling stays an enjoyable pastime rather than a cause of stress. Through adopting these practices, gamblers can cultivate a more balanced and long-lasting approach to gaming.
